August 31 2019
Jordan Ayew
Crystal Palace secured their first home win of the season after a 1-0 victory over 10-man Aston Villa.
Palace eventually broke down a resilient Villa who had Trezeguet sent off for a second booking in the 54th minute.
Roy Hodgson's side dominated throughout with 22 shots on goal and 13 corners but lacked a cutting edge.
Former Villa striker Jordan Ayew got the only goal of the game in the 73rd minute. The Ghana international raced on to Jeffrey Schlupp's through ball and wormed his way beyond Tyrone Mings and Jack Grealish before firing into the far corner.
Villa were furious to be denied a Henri Lansbury 'goal' six minutes into stoppage time after referee Kevin Friend decided that Jack Grealish dived in the build-up.
Palace move up to fourth in the early Premier League table after claiming a back-to-back victory.
Palace: Guaita, Ward, Cahill, Kelly (Sakho 79), Van Aanholt, Schlupp (Townsend 84), McArthur, Milivojevic, Kouyate, Zaha, Ayew (Benteke 86).
Not used: Hennessey, McCarthy, Camarasa, Meyer.
Villa: Heaton, Taylor, Mings, Engels, Guilbert, Luiz (Hourihaane 71), Trezeguet, Grealish, McGinn, Jota (Davis 59), Wesley (Lansbury 85).
Not used: Steer, Ngoyo, Elmohamady, El Ghazi.
